The Risks & Why PR is Crucial
The risks are multifaceted․ Beyond personal embarrassment, a poorly handled situation can lead to:
- Brand Damage: Especially damaging if the figure represents family values or a conservative brand․
- Loss of Trust: Perceived hypocrisy erodes public trust․
- Career Implications: Contracts can be lost, endorsements withdrawn․
- Legal Issues: Depending on the circumstances (consent, age of consent, etc․)․
- Social Media Backlash: Rapid and often unforgiving online scrutiny․
Effective PR isn’t about denying the event (if evidence exists – denial is rarely successful)․ It’s about controlling the narrative, minimizing damage, and demonstrating accountability (where appropriate)․ Ignoring the issue is almost always the worst approach; silence is often interpreted as guilt or arrogance․

The Statement – Tone & Content
The initial statement is critical․ Consider these approaches:
- Acknowledgement (with Privacy Request): “We are aware of the reports and ask for respect for everyone’s privacy during this personal matter․” (Suitable for less prominent figures)․
- Brief Explanation (if appropriate): “This was a regrettable lapse in judgment․ I take full responsibility for my actions․” (Requires careful consideration – admitting fault can be risky)․
- Focus on Values: “I am committed to my family and my work․ This isolated incident does not reflect my character․” (Useful if the individual has a strong public persona)․
Avoid: Blaming the other party, providing excessive detail, or appearing dismissive․

Ethical Considerations
One-Night Stand PR raises significant ethical concerns․ Protecting the privacy of all parties involved is paramount․ The PR team must avoid victim-blaming or exploiting the situation for publicity․ Transparency and honesty are essential, even when the truth is uncomfortable․
The Role of Social Media
Social media amplifies both the crisis and the potential for recovery․ A swift, well-crafted response on platforms like Twitter and Facebook is crucial․ Ignoring negative comments or engaging in online arguments can exacerbate the situation․ Consider a temporary pause on social media activity to allow the situation to cool down․
